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:10 mins
Total Time:25 mins
Servings: 2

Ingredients

  • 12 pieces Fresh oysters
  • 1 teaspoon Ground cumin
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 2 cloves Garlic
  • 1 whole Lime
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h cilantro
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oon Chili flakes (optional)

Directions

Step 1

Shuck the oysters carefully using an oyster knife, retaining as much of the liquid (liquor) as possible in the shells. Place the shucked oysters on a plate or baking tray covered with rock salt to keep them stable.

Step 2

In a small bowl, combine the ground cumin, olive oil, minced garlic, salt, black pepper, and chili flakes (if using). Mix well to form a marinade.

Step 3

Preheat a grill or broiler to medium-high heat.

Step 4

Spoon a small amount of the marinade onto each oyster, ensuring it spreads lightly over the meat and mixes with the liquor.

Step 5

Place the oysters on the grill or under the broiler. Cook for about 5-7 minutes, or until the oysters begin to curl at the edges and are heated through, taking care not to overcook.

Step 6

While the oysters are cooking, finely chop the cilantro and cut the lime into wedges.

Step 7

Remove the oysters from the heat and sprinkle with fresh cilantro. Serve immediately with lime wedges on the side for squeezing over the oysters.

Step 8

Enjoy your cumin-infused oysters with a side of crusty bread or a light green salad!
